🐟 1. Fish Oil for Joint Lubrication: Dive into the benefits of Omega-3 fatty acids found in fish oil, supporting heart health and reducing inflammation. Learn how virgin cod liver oil, rich in Vitamin D, can be your natural remedy for joint pain.

ðŸĶī 2. Collagen – The Joint’s Best Friend: Explore the role of collagen in joint flexibility and the importance of type II collagen from chicken cartilage. Discover how collagen supplements and collagen-rich foods like bone broth can aid in joint regeneration.

🍊 3. Vitamin C – More Than Just Immunity: Uncover the joint-supporting properties of Vitamin C, essential in collagen synthesis. Learn creative ways to incorporate Vitamin C-rich foods into your diet for a holistic approach to joint health.

ðŸŒķïļ 4. Turmeric and Curcumin’s Anti-Inflammatory Power: Journey into the ancient Ayurvedic use of turmeric and the science behind curcumin’s ability to reduce inflammation. Get tips on maximizing turmeric’s benefits with the help of black pepper.

☀ïļ 5. The Sunshine Vitamin – Vitamin D: Understand the critical role of Vitamin D in calcium absorption and joint inflammation reduction. Explore natural sources and practical tips for maintaining optimal Vitamin D levels.

🧀 6. Vitamin K2 – The Calcium Conductor: Learn how Vitamin K2 directs calcium to the right places, preventing joint pain and supporting cardiovascular health. Discover fermented foods as sources and the option of supplementation.

ðŸŒŋ 7. Ginger – Nature’s Anti-Inflammatory: Spice up your joint health with ginger’s anti-inflammatory properties. Whether in tea, meals, or supplements, find easy ways to incorporate this potent root into your daily routine.

⚖ïļ 8. Magnesium – The Relaxation Mineral: Unwind with the “relaxation mineral” magnesium. Explore magnesium-rich foods and topical applications to relieve joint stiffness and pain.

ðŸĨ› 9. Calcium – Building Blocks for Strong Joints: Delve into the synergy of calcium and Vitamin D for robust joint health. Identify excellent dietary sources and understand the importance of this dynamic duo.

Care let’s start with number one fish oil omega-3 fatty acids found in fish oil help support healthy heart function improve skin conditions and enhance mental performance fish oil also has anti-inflammatory properties that can help mitigate inflammatory processes ass associated with arthritis and rheumatoid arthritis providing relief to individuals suffering from joint pain A

Major benefit of fish oil is its ability to support joint health by promoting the production of lubricating fluids in the joints thereby enhancing mobility and flexibility cod liver oil can also help lubricate the joints and prevent pain and swelling consuming 1 to two teaspoons per day of Virgin cod liver

Oil is the most effective way to provide relief to individuals suffering from joint pain in comparison to fish oil cod liver oil contains more vitamin D which helps with calcium absorption and reduces joint inflammation alternatively consuming more Seafood such as wild CAU Cod mackerel and salmon which are natural sources of highquality nutrients

For optimal joint health can also provide relief now let’s talk about number two collagen cartilage the connective tissue that cushions and promotes joint flexibility is composed primarily of collagen collagen production naturally declines as we age making joints more susceptible to injury joint pain can be managed by incorporating collagen supplements into

Your daily routine this supplement contributes to cartilage regeneration as well as reducing friction between bones to use joint discomfort choosing the right type of collagen supplement is crucial in particular type 2 collagen which is derived from chicken cartilage is beneficial for maintaining joint health Studies have shown that this type

Of collagen helps maintain joint function and reduces osteoarthritis symptoms adding collagen rich foods into your diet such as bone broth fish and lean meats can complement collagen supplementation and provide a holistic approach to joint health moving on to number three vitamin C is well known for its immune boosting properties but it

Also supports joint health in the synthesis of collagen ascorbic acid the active form of vitamin C is crucial therefore it’s important to include excellent sources of vitamin C in one’s diet such as black currants sauerkraut acerola cherries raw leafy greens and citrus fruits a whole fruit powder such

As acerola Cherry Camu Camu or rose hips can provide the full vitamin C complex you can add a teaspoon or two of the fruit powder to your morning smoothies or fresh juices let’s move on to number four turmeric has been used in atic medicine for over 4,000 years often

Referred to as Indian saffron the active ingredient in turmeric is curcumin which helps reduce inflammation and swelling in joint tissue a primary cause of joint pain is inflammation and circumin works by inhibiting multiple inflammatory Pathways thereby alleviating pain and discomfort associated with arthritis the ability of kirkin to inhibit

Inflammatory enzymes and block signaling molecules makes it a promising natural alternative ative to treat joint Related Disorders turmeric has poor bioavailability which means that most of what is consumed is not absorbed into the bloodstream and is rapidly processed and eliminated however black pepper contains piperine a compound that has

Been shown to increase curcumin’s bioavailability by 2,000% you can take turmeric every day up to 2,000 mg five vitamin D another extremely important nutrient for the joints is vitamin D bones and joints need Vitamin D to stay healthy vitamin D helps your body absorb calcium which is

Critical to bone health as well as reduce joint inflammation a diet rich in Vitamin D rich foods such as fatty fish fortified dairy products and eggs can also relieve joint pain there are billions of people around the world who are vitamin D deficient which can weaken their joints and make them more

Susceptible to fractures and bending sunlight is the primary natural source of V vitamin D but factors such as geographic location season and skin pigmentation can impact synthesis six vitamin K2 while vitamin D AIDS in calcium absorption vitamin K2 is the conductor that directs calcium to where it is needed and prevents its deposition

In the wrong places one of vitamin k2’s critical functions is to activate proteins that regulate calcium ensuring its incorporation into bones and teeth while preventing its accumulation in artery and soft tissues this meticulous orchestration of calcium metabolism is pivotal in preventing joint pain and maintaining overall cardiovascular

Health vitamin K2 is found in fermented foods such as natto cheese and sauerkraut however the Western diet is often deficient in these sources making supplementation a practical option seven ginger a root spice renowned for its distinct flavor and Aroma is also a potent anti-inflammatory agent it contains Ginger o a compound that

Reduces inflammation and eases joint pain additionally research has also shown the effectiveness of topical ginger as creams or Oils for localized joint pain relief whether you prefer a soothing cup of ginger tea a spicy addition to your meals or a helpful supplement Ginger can easily fit into

Your daily routine brew a cup of ginger tea by steeping fresh ginger slices and steaming hot water for a more concentrated dose Ginger supplement are available in various forms such as capsules powders or extracts eight magnesium the mineral magnesium often referred to as the relaxation mineral

Plays a crucial role in the function of muscles and nerves it helps relax muscles which relieves joint stiffness and pain magnesium rich foods such as dark leafy greens nuts seeds and whole grains should be included in a joint friendly diet topical magnesium oil or magnesium baths can also provide

Localized relief nine calcium is widely recognized for its role in maintaining bone health adequate calcium intake is crucial for strong and healthy joints as it helps maintain bone density and support overall joint function dairy products leafy greens and fortified plant-based milk alternatives are excellent dietary sources of calcium

However it’s important to note that calcium absorption is enhanced when paired with vitamin D as I have already mentioned now that you know some of the key nutrients needed to alleviate joint pain here are some general tips to alleviate joint pain one maintain a healthy weight you may feel strain on

Your joints especially in weightbearing areas like your knees and hips if you’re overweight or obese maintaining a healthy weight can alleviate pain two hot and cold therapy using heat or cold on the affected joint can relieve pain and inflammation in general cold packs are preferred for for acute injuries

While heat packs provide soothing relief for chronic conditions four proper posture try to keep your spine aligned and your joints in a neutral position whether you are sitting or standing to avoid unnecessary joint stress five manage stress stress can exacerbate pain consider incorporating stress reducing techniques into your daily routine such

As meditation deep breathing and mindfulness foods to avoid to prevent joint pain Omega 6 fatty acids although omega-6 fatty acids are essential for the body an imbalance between omega-6 fatty acids and omega-3 fatty acids can cause inflammation eat fatty fish flax seeds and chia seeds instead of vegetable oils such as corn sunflower
